The Landscape of Bitcoin ETFs in Sweden
Sweden has distinguished itself as a forward-thinking nation in the realm of digital currency investment. The country is home to several Bitcoin Exchange Traded Funds (ETFs
), designed to track the performance of Bitcoin, thus offering investors exposure to the cryptocurrency without the complexities of direct ownership. One of the most prominent features of the Swedish market is the XBT Provider, which offers Bitcoin Tracker One and Bitcoin Tracker Euro, among the first of their kind in the world.
The price of Bitcoin ETFs in Sweden, like their counterparts globally, is subject to volatility reflective of the cryptocurrency market’s inherent fluctuations. However, by offering a regulated investment avenue, these ETFs provide a measure of security and ease of access that direct cryptocurrency investments do not always afford.
Investment Opportunities and Risks
Investing in Bitcoin ETFs in Sweden presents a unique mix of opportunities and risks. On the one hand, these instruments offer Swedish and international investors a way to gain exposure to Bitcoin’s potential upsides without needing to engage directly with the cryptocurrency market. On the other hand, the volatility of Bitcoin’s price remains an inextricable risk factor. Therefore, prospective investors in Sweden’s Bitcoin ETFs must conduct thorough research, considering the ETF’s track record, management fees, and the broader state of the cryptocurrency market.
Moreover, the regulatory environment in Sweden is conducive to cryptocurrency investments, with the Swedish Financial Supervisory Authority (Finansinspektionen) having a relatively open stance towards digital assets. This regulatory backdrop provides a level of assurance to investors but does not eliminate the market’s inherent risks.
Understanding Price Movements
The price of Bitcoin ETFs in Sweden, similar to that of Bitcoin itself, is influenced by a myriad of factors including market demand, investor sentiment, and global economic indicators. Since these ETFs replicate the price movement of Bitcoin, any fluctuations in the global price of Bitcoin are mirrored in the ETF’s valuation. Investors should keep abreast of market trends, news, and analyses to make informed decisions.
Notably, the liquidity of Bitcoin ETFs in Sweden also plays a crucial role in determining price stability and investment viability. As the market matures and more investors participate, it is plausible to anticipate greater price stability and growth prospects for these investment vehicles.
